Question

An element has its electron configuration as 2, 8, 2. Now answer the following question. 

With which of the following elements would this element resemble?
(Atomic numbers are given in the brackets)
N(7), Be(4), Ar(18), Cl(17)

Short Answer
Advertisements

Solution

The element would resemble beryllium (Be).

Explanation:

The given element has an electron configuration of 2, 8, 2, indicating that it contains two electrons in its outermost shell. It resembles beryllium (Be), which likewise possesses two valence electrons. Elements with the same number of valence electrons have similar chemical characteristics. Thus, the provided element resembles beryllium.
